http://www.metaris.com/hp-relations.php WebMetric Horsepower, hp (M) —75 kgf-m per second, approximately 735.499 watts Boiler Horsepower, hp (S) —34.5 pounds of water evaporated per hour at 212 degrees Fahrenheit, approximately 9,809.5 watts. This definition is mainly used to denote a boiler's capacity to deliver steam to a steam engine. Electrical Horsepower —746 watts.
